Transaction 86c70faa64a2cba03f4218893c5f3f635063fbb9f182e2b2edbee683b48a3006
1 Input
1 Output
-
86c70faa64a2cba03f4218893c5f3f635063fbb9f182e2b2edbee683b48a3006:0
- value
- 43370925
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5cdfaab8187b4d911dfe9322da855b53008916c
- address
- bc1qkhxl42ups76djywlayezm2z4k5cq3ytv9qda4c